Output 662b1606a8c2a2475984c4dfe2a5d74687315244467fae25161d38e1a2914b34:0

value
8738892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d4662fee40844579d967a54500a488866b64c28 OP_EQUAL
address
34MoqfGZkBxfZQ9sCRB7CN9xRPNKq5SjCv
transaction
662b1606a8c2a2475984c4dfe2a5d74687315244467fae25161d38e1a2914b34
confirmations
314488
spent
true